[0082] First, refer to figure 1 An example electronic device 100 for implementing the bottom database data processing method and a face recognition method according to the embodiment of the present invention will be described. The electronic device 100 in this example may be a mobile terminal such as a smart phone, a tablet computer, a wearable device, a notebook computer, or an electronic camera; it may also be other devices such as an identity verification device, a monitor, or a server of a monitoring center. Wherein, the identity verification device may be an attendance machine or an all-in-one witness machine. The monitor can be used to record and store the acquired video and audio signals by using the camera storage device, and perform face recognition based on the stored audio and video signals. The server in the monitoring center can be used to store the acquired audio and video data on the network side, and to detect and recognize faces on the network side.

[0091] This embodiment provides a bottom library data processing method. Compared with the prior art, this method adds detailed area information in the bottom library data, and can implement effective maintenance and maintenance of the detailed area information in the bottom library data. Updated to provide reliable detailed area information for face recognition, and then be able to consider face detail features during face recognition, improve the accuracy of face recognition, and improve the efficiency of face recognition.
